In his literary work for ‘Arp im Ohr’, the 2024 literature scholarship holder, the award-winning poet Christian Steinbacher from Linz an der Donau, has dedicated himself to texts by Hans Arp and works by Sophie Taeuber-Arp. Following the sound of her language and the traces of concrete art and poetry, he fragments text and image components and processes them into new compositions. In his reading, the poet and performer will also present samples of his previous poetry.
The literary scholarship is awarded annually in co-operation with the Literaturhaus Edenkoben and includes a 3-month stay in the artist's flat at the Arp Museum.
Christian Steinbacher, born in Austria in 1960, has lived in Linz since 1984. Book publications since 1988, since 2011 mainly with Czernin Verlag in Vienna.
